Ball Valves

Ball Valves for Aramco Projects

Ball valves are the most widely specified isolation valves in Saudi Aramco projects. Their quarter-turn operation, minimal flow resistance, and reliable bubble-tight shutoff make them the default choice for hydrocarbon service on NPS ½ through NPS 24 lines.

Aramco's primary ball valve specification is 04-SAMSS-035 (for general service) and 04-SAMSS-048 (for trunnion-mounted large bore). For SAEP-347 stockist supply, four distinct material numbers cover the major ball valve configurations, segregated by size range, body material (steel vs non-ferrous), and port design (standard vs multiport).

When to Specify a Ball Valve

  • On/off isolation service (not throttling)
  • Hydrocarbon service requiring bubble-tight shutoff
  • Lines NPS ½ to NPS 2 (socket weld or threaded ends)
  • Lines NPS 2 to NPS 24 (flanged or butt weld ends)
  • When actuator mounting is required
  • When frequent cycling is expected

Body Material Selection: Steel body (A216 WCB or A105) for hydrocarbon and general process service. Non-ferrous (brass/bronze, ASTM B148) for utility water, instrument air, and seawater service where iron contamination is a concern.

Gate Valves

Gate Valves for Aramco Projects

Gate valves are used where full unobstructed bore is required and where the valve will remain either fully open or fully closed for extended periods. Unlike ball valves, gate valves are not suited to frequent cycling — the sliding wedge mechanism wears under repeated operation.

For Aramco projects, gate valves are typically specified on larger lines (NPS 4 and above) in pressure classes from 150 to 4500. The applicable standard depends on size and material: API 602 for compact steel gate valves up to NPS 4, API 600 for larger steel gate valves, and AWWA C500/C509 for cast iron utility gate valves.

When to Specify a Gate Valve

  • Large bore lines (NPS 4 and above) requiring full-bore flow
  • Infrequent operation (open/close cycles)
  • High-pressure, high-temperature service (Class 600+)
  • Utility water and raw water systems (cast iron body)
  • Slurry and viscous service where bore obstruction would cause plugging

Globe Valves

Globe Valves — Throttling Service

Globe valves are the preferred choice where flow must be regulated or throttled. The disc-and-seat design allows precise flow control and makes them ideal for steam tracing, pressure-reducing service, and bypass lines.

The primary limitation of globe valves is high pressure drop — the S-shaped flow path creates significantly more resistance than a ball or gate valve. This makes them unsuitable for main process lines where pressure drop must be minimized. Aramco specification: API 602 (compact, NPS ≤4) and 04-SAMSS-035.

Butterfly Valves

Butterfly Valves — Low-Pressure Utility

Butterfly valves offer a compact, lightweight, cost-effective solution for large-bore, low-pressure service. In Aramco applications they are typically limited to ANSI Class 150 and are used in cooling water, fire water, potable water, and low-pressure utility gas systems.

The key limitation is shutoff — butterfly valves do not achieve the bubble-tight zero-leakage shutoff that ball or gate valves provide. They are not suitable for hydrocarbon service above Class 150 on Aramco projects. Aramco specification: API 609 and 04-SAMSS-035.

Quick Reference

Quick Valve Selection by Service Type

Crude Oil / Hydrocarbon Process
Use: Ball valves (small bore), Gate valves (large bore)
Why: Bubble-tight shutoff required; zero tolerance for leakage
Steam Service
Use: Globe valves (throttling), Gate valves (isolation)
Why: Globe for precise control; gate for main line shutoff
Cooling Water / Fire Water
Use: Butterfly valves (large bore, Class 150), Gate valves (cast iron)
Why: Low pressure, large bore — weight/cost savings with butterfly
Instrument / Sample Lines
Use: Ball valves (small bore, threaded or socket weld)
Why: Compact, reliable shutoff on ½" to 2" instrument piping
Pump Discharge / Backflow Prevention
Use: Check valves (swing or dual plate)
Why: Automatic closure prevents reverse flow without manual operation
Produced Water / Slurry
Use: Plug valves (cast iron body, Class 150–600)
Why: Smooth bore resists buildup; easy to strip-line and clean
